Lead CT Technologist

  • Hourly Rate: $44.00-54.00 commensurate with experience

Here is what you will need:

  • Graduation from high school or equivalent and completion of a training program in imaging technology from an accredited school.
  • Must be registered by the American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(CT).
  • Should be able to lift and move patients as required
  • Must become certified in cardiopulmonary resuscitation within one year of employment and renew certification annually
  • All technologists working in the Maryland and Virginia offices must be licensed by the state

A Day in the Life of a CT Tech:

  • Provide services and support for the following areas:
    • Perform x-ray and CT procedures as prescribed by a physician.
    • Must be able to recognize reactions to contrast media and be ready to intervene when necessary by administering CPR.
    • Assure all necessary consent forms are signed prior to performing examinations. Correctly process pertinent exam related information including charge slips and/or direct computer entry as directed.  Should be familiar with the operation of the clerical and reception areas of the office and assist when needed, including the management of patient records and files.
    • Actively participate in the quality assurance monitoring and recording efforts of the office.
    • Reduce radiation exposure to patients to a minimum to the patient, staff, and self by understanding and utilizing proper technical factors, collimation, and shielding without jeopardizing the diagnostic study.
    • Report any equipment and maintenance problems to the appropriate persons regarding equipment operation, malfunctions, etc., and perform preventative/corrective maintenance as needed.
    • Must maintain confidentiality when dealing with all patient information and Corporate business.
    • Communicate courteously with coworkers and handle interpersonal problem situations discretely and through the proper chain of command.
